When we first introduced GiGi Girls with their dreamy song “Baci Al Sole,” it was clear they had a knack for nostalgic Italo-pop glow. Since then, the Cologne-based trio have dropped more bops like “Amore Per Sempre” and “Il Futuro,” continuing to shape the sound of their upcoming debut album, Greatest Hits, out later this month.
Now they’re back with “L’Anima,” a softer, more introspective step forward that “grew out of conversations about AI and what it does to the way we feel and create.” The track boasts the kind of soothing atmospheres we adore over here, with warm flute and saxophone textures taking center stage. It also features the always amazing John Moods, whose smooth and laidback touch lifts the whole piece. As the band shared, “We connected through the scene—we’ve been big fans of his music for a while. Through his concert series ‘Neu, kaputt,’ Janosch has organised concerts for him and also worked on some music videos with him.” Listen to “L’Anima” below.
